The dispersity of a polymer sample if often between 1 and 2 (although it can be even higher than 2). The closer it is to 1, the narrower the distribution. WebBasic Antibody Structure. Immunoglobulins (Igs) are produced by B lymphocytes and secreted into plasma. The Ig molecule in monomeric form is a glycoprotein with a molecular weight of approximately 150 kDa that is shaped more or less like a Y. WebThe molar mass of a substance, also often called molecular mass or molecular weight (although the definitions are not strictly identical, but it is only sensitive in very defined areas), is the weight of a defined amount of molecules of the substance (a mole) and is expressed in g/mol. WebThe molecular mass ( m) is the mass of a given molecule: it is measured in daltons or atomic mass (Da or u). [1] [2] Different molecules of the same compound may have different molecular masses because they contain different isotopes of an element.
